I am writing from London as the Aussie Stingers are here to use the Olympic facility in the ‘London Prepares’ test event.  We start off our campaign against Great Britain tomorrow, the USA Friday and Hungary Saturday.  This is straight off the back of our Australian National League finals last week in Sydney.  My team, the Brisbane Barracudas won the minor premiership going into the finals series, but couldn’t take anything for granted, as any of the top four women’s teams could take it out on the day.  The courier mail featured us (picture attached) in the lead up. We defeated favourite Victorian Tigers in a very hard fought semi-final to take us to the Grand Final against the Cronulla Sharks.  This was a rematch of last years Grand Final, which saw us claw our way back from a 5 goal deficit, to force our way into extra time, and win on a penalty shoot-out for our third consecutive National League title.  Things went a little bit differently this year, and it just wasn’t our day.  The Sharks goalie had a stellar game and we struggled to get anything past her.  Our sharp shooter Kate Gynther rocketed 2 in the net, and I managed to get a centre forward goal passed her, to give the Barras our 3 goals.  The Sharks managed 6 goals for a fairly easy victory. So our fairy tale ending didn’t eventuate, but onwards and upwards as they say.  As I mentioned before, we are now in London for a week, then head to Japan next week for World League preliminaries, then Shaghai for an intensive training camp, then Changshu for World League Super Finals.
